  1. How to hard reset BLACKBERRY PlayBook. If the display is off, press the Power key to turn it back on. Form the home screen find and select Settings. Then tap Security and choose Security Wipe. Enter the word blackberry in the text field. Tap Wipe Data to intiate the security wipe process. Well done!

  4. Switch on the cell phone. Then goto device options. Select Security Options -> General Settings. Next press Menu button to confirm. Choose Wipe handheld, and select checkbox of things to reset.   6. How to hard reset BLACKBERRY 7230. First turn on the phone. Next select to Options -> Security -> Wipe handheld. Now type the word BlackBerry. Then your phone will reboots and resets.
